When the ministry announced the funding review in March 2022, it said the model hadn’t been updated in over 20 years and has ...
RENO, Nev., Nov. 03, 2025 (GLOBE NEWSWIRE) -- Ormat Technologies, Inc. (NYSE: ORA) (the “Company” or “Ormat”), a leading renewable energy company, today announced financial results for the third 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results